Job description

This is a full-time hybrid role as a Penetration Tester, primarily remote with occasional on-site work as required. You will be responsible for delivering high-quality penetration testing across systems, networks and applications, identifying vulnerabilities, and clearly communicating mitigation and remediation strategies to clients.

You will work both independently and collaboratively, contributing to team development and assisting with Red Team activities, project scoping, and continuous improvement initiatives.

Primary focus:

  • Web application and API testing
  • Internal and external infrastructure assessments

You may also support:

  • Cloud environment security reviews
  • Red Team and social engineering components

Requirements

Do you have experience in Scripting?, Essential:

  • A recognised industry certification - e.g., PNPT, CSTM, CRT, OSCP, CPTS
  • Minimum 2 years' hands-on penetration testing experience
  • Strong understanding of industry best practices, security controls, and compliance guidelines
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ving abilities
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to explain complex issues to technical and non-technical stakeholders
  • High-quality report writing ability
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
  • Must be located and eligible to work in the UK

Desirable:

  • Experience with Azure or AWS security assessments
  • Scripting/programming abilities (Python, Bash, PowerShell)
  • Familiarity with Red Team adversary emulation
  • Mobile Security Testing
